码迷,mamicode.com
首页 >  
搜索关键字:二进制优化    ( 102个结果
POJ 1014 Dividing 背包
二进制优化,事实上是物体的分解问题。 就是比方一个物体有数量限制,比方是13,那么就须要把这个物体分解为1。 2, 4, 6 假设这个物体有数量为25,那么就分解为1, 2, 4。 8。 10 看出规律吗,就是分成2的倍数加上位数,比方6 = 13 - 1 - 2 - 4, 10 = 25 - 1 ...
分类:其他好文   时间:2017-06-05 15:46:53    阅读次数:140
[多重背包+二进制优化]HDU1059 Dividing
题目链接 题目大意: 两个人要把一堆宝珠,在不能切割的情况下按照价值平分,他们把宝珠分成6种价值,每种价值的宝珠n个。 n<=200000 思考: 首先如果加和下来的价值是一个偶数 那么还分毛啊,直接gg. 之后多重背包二进制优化 转换为 01背包。 我们可以把价值 同时当做宝珠的空间和价值。 那么 ...
分类:其他好文   时间:2017-06-01 21:36:43    阅读次数:244
51nod 1086 背包问题 V2(二进制优化多重背包)
题目链接:https://www.51nod.com/onlineJudge/questionCode.html#!problemId=1086 题解:怎么用二进制优化多重背包,举一个例子就明白了。 如果要放n个苹果,可以将n个苹果分成几个2的次方1,2,3,4,m^2然后n可以由这些按照某种组合来 ...
分类:其他好文   时间:2017-05-19 18:37:50    阅读次数:143
基本数论算法
dalao博客,至少很好看。。 因为本人数论实在渣渣,但是考试确是得考的,只好尽早学,尽早掌握。 最大公因数 普通gcd 1 inline int gcd(int x,int y) 2 { 3 return y == 0 ? x : gcd(y, x % y) 4 } 二进制优化gcd 1 inli ...
分类:编程语言   时间:2017-05-09 21:45:27    阅读次数:180
POJ 1014 Dividing(多重背包+二进制优化)
http://poj.org/problem?id=1014 题意:6个物品,每个物品都有其价值和数量,判断是否能价值平分。 思路: 多重背包。利用二进制来转化成0-1背包求解。 ...
分类:其他好文   时间:2017-03-17 14:48:34    阅读次数:199
1531: [POI2005]Bank notes二进制优化(c++)
Description Byteotian Bit Bank (BBB) 拥有一套先进的货币系统,这个系统一共有n种面值的硬币,面值分别为b1, b2,..., bn. 但是每种硬币有数量限制,现在我们想要凑出面值k求最少要用多少个硬币. Byteotian Bit Bank (BBB) 拥有一套先 ...
分类:编程语言   时间:2016-12-22 00:28:59    阅读次数:252
lightoj1200_完全背包二进制优化
http://lightoj.com/volume_showproblem.php?problem=1200 A thief has entered into a super shop at midnight. Poor thief came here because his wife has se ...
分类:其他好文   时间:2016-10-15 22:15:13    阅读次数:279
lightoj1233_二进制优化
http://lightoj.com/volume_showproblem.php?problem=1233 一维多重背包二进制优化的思考:先看这个问题,100=1+2+4+8+16+32+37,观察可以得出100以内任何一个数都可以由以上7个数选择组合得到,所以对物品数目就不是从0都100遍历,而 ...
分类:其他好文   时间:2016-10-15 21:55:58    阅读次数:195
Light oj 1233 - Coin Change (III) (背包优化)
题目链接:http://www.lightoj.com/volume_showproblem.php?problem=1233 题目就不说明了。 背包的二进制优化,比如10可以表示为1 2 4 3,而这些数能表示1 ~ 10的任意的数。然后类似01背包就好了。 ...
分类:其他好文   时间:2016-10-15 21:47:48    阅读次数:119
二模07day2解题报告
T1.采药(medic) 有n个草药,要在m的时间内获得最大价值。 乍一看像是01背包,然而数据只能过50分。 考虑数据范围,t<=10,w<=10,所以只有121种草药。考虑多重背包的二进制优化,先统计每种草药的数量,然后可以拆成1,2,4,8……个草药(捆绑成一棵)然后就01背包 T2.方格取数 ...
分类:其他好文   时间:2016-10-05 15:11:50    阅读次数:151
102条   上一页 1 ... 4 5 6 7 8 ... 11 下一页
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!